In an excellent interview with Submission Radio, Koscheck pretty much laid his whole view on the UFC life he left behind out on the line. Here's a quick snippet and the interview below:
"Even if I never fought again after that last contract, this last fight that I had, I wasn’t going to re sign with them, because it’s simple - you put 27 fights in, you give them 10 years of your life, you’d think that they would have stepped up to the game or stepped up to the plate and put a job offer in front of me or something to keep me involved with the UFC and the sport," he said.
